Homeowner associations liquidated in Kashkadarya region
Instead of homeowner associations, there will be created management organizations.
According to the press service of the Regional Office of Housing and Public Utilities, there are currently 161 homeowner associations operating in 1,903 multi-storey houses in Kashkadarya.
“However, these partnerships do not perform their work properly. Many apartment buildings in the region have been seriously damaged due to the fact that roofing, basement, communication systems, playgrounds and adjacent territories were not repaired by enterprises for many years,” the report says.
It is noted that people have lost confidence in these organizations and have not paid their contributions. As a result, public arrears in mandatory contributions exceeded 3.5 billion soums. The quality of services has deteriorated. In the last three years, all the repairs of the multi-storey houses were carried out with funds from the local budget.
According to the law “On the Management of Apartment Houses”, the region intends to create 10 managing organizations, which will serve 694 multi-storey houses. The relevant agencies are currently discussing these issues with the public.
